Most reported cases the victim has been very over weight, smokes constantly, alcoholic, wore clothes that have been out of style since the early 20th century that were highly flammable. It is believed they fell asleep smoking, dropped their smoke, which caught their clothes on fire, being drunk they did not wake up, the fire melted body fat which wicked into the clothes, causing the "candle effect".
Reporting on the conditions of these fires has also tended to be inaccurate and sensational.
